The cost of pursuing an MS at K.D. Medical College Hospital and Research Centre varies depending on the specialty you're interested in. Here are some examples of the total tuition fees for different MS courses:
- MS in Ophthalmology: 64.92 Lakh
- MD Dermatology, V&L: 21,63,946
- MD General Medicine: 21,63,946
- MD Paediatrics: 21,63,946
- MD Radio-diagnosis: 21,63,946
- MD Respiratory Medicine: 21,63,946
- MS Obstetrics & Gynecology: 21,63,946
- MS Orthopedics: 21,63,946
- MS Otorhinolaryngology (ENT): 21,63,946
- MD Psychiatry: 17,00,000

K.D. Medical College Hospital and Research Centre in Mathura, India, is known for its quality education, affordable admissions, and well-qualified faculty. It features a 720-bed multi-specialty hospital with modern facilities, including a fully equipped ICU, emergency lab, and sample collection center, ensuring comprehensive healthcare services.

NEET UG cutoff for 2023 for admission in MBBS at K.D. Medical College Hospital and Research Centre has been released. The last round closing rank for the general category was 243,445.
